Accademia 21

Accademia 21 is a bed and breakfast in the historic centre of Mantua, 150 metres from Piazza delle Erbe and a short walk from the Duomo and Palazzo Ducale, in the heart of the city’s UNESCO area.

The property occupies the first floor of a historic building on Via Accademia and offers rooms with a view of the city or the inner courtyard, designed for both short and extended stays. Each room has a private bathroom with bidet and toiletries, air conditioning, soundproofed walls, flat-screen TV, minibar, coffee machine and toaster: details that make the accommodation suitable both for couples and small groups thanks to the Basic Triple Room.

Breakfast, served in several variants including vegetarian, vegan and gluten-free, is complemented by a daily housekeeping service and the option of private check-in. The central location, particularly appreciated by couples with a score of 9.9, allows guests to reach the city’s main monuments on foot and the railway station in about one kilometre, making Accademia 21 a practical base for visiting Mantua without a car.

Location & what to see

Accademia 21 is located on Via Accademia, right in the historic centre of Mantua, within the area recognised as a UNESCO World Heritage Site that encompasses the city’s main monuments. The area is pedestrian and lively, with Renaissance palaces, small streets lined with shops and cafés that bring the centre to life from the morning onwards, a short walk from Piazza delle Erbe and the covered market beneath Palazzo della Ragione.

Mantua Cathedral and Palazzo Ducale are both about 150 metres away, while the State Archive and Palazzo dell’Accademia are less than 100 metres from the entrance. Mantua Railway Station can be reached on foot in about 1 km and connects the city with Verona, Milan and Modena; Verona-Villafranca Airport, the closest, is about 25 km away, while Parma Airport is about 53 km away. For those looking for restaurants and cafés, venues such as Ma dai, I Feudi and Le Pupitre 18 can be found within a few dozen metres.

Guests staying at Accademia 21 can spend a day at Palazzo Te, the famous museum about 1.5 km away, among the masterpieces of Lombard Mannerist architecture, or take a walk along the lakes surrounding the old town. In summer, an excursion to the Bosco della Fontana Nature Reserve, about 6 km away, one of the few surviving lowland forests of the Po Valley, is recommended, while in cooler months the historic centre, with its squares and markets, remains the main destination for a walking visit.
